I'd appreciate any help from you all...we have had a loft extension which involves another flight of stairs with new posts (pine) and handrail (hardwood). The existing banisters and posts on the lower floors match and are a very dark oak like colour and varnished. Obviously I'd like to get them old and new to be one colour and finish. I have tried on some test wood, various woodstains and varnishes and I can't get the new post and banister types to match each other let alone the original. Can any one help on the best methods on the following

a) getting old banisters recoloured/varnished - do I need to take back to bare wood and if so how- I have tried sanding and the sandpaper just gets a grunge film on it?

b) getting all the wood to the same colour finish?

c) any suggestions on makes -e.g. is sikkens the best to use here?

Many thanks in advance...
 
its a complicated job, you need a french polisher. Not a diy process really. Lots of factors involved not least potential fading of newly applied stains/ stained finishes...
